Transaction 5ca949e8b22616ee3bae8ad63101b93b26e41773856de62666711c640689cce2
1 Input
1 Output
-
5ca949e8b22616ee3bae8ad63101b93b26e41773856de62666711c640689cce2:0
- value
- 30500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cacdcf58f4d67a202b7a66e4fe4118c32d38f186 OP_EQUAL
- address
- 3LBLyDgycXsywofeX3ZcQhziocsH5uXM3x